Port Isolation on VLAN subnets
This feature can be used to isolate devices in the same VLAN from each other while allowing them to access external resources (e.g., the internet, a router, or a server). Difference between 2.4 Ghz and 5 Ghz frequency bands on Wifi communication
The 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z wireless networks are wireless communications wireless networks. Each is distinct in advantage and disadvantage depending on application.
